Brenmar is the club. This bass music chameleon has soundtracked some of the best nights of our lives with sets that expertly travel from Jersey to Chicago and beyond, connecting the dots between hip-hop, R&B and all manner of futuristic house music production. His aptly titled Award EP (out 1/20 on Fool’s Gold) is more than a victory lap for a nightlife champion, but the start of an awesome new chapter, melding songwriting chops atop years of body-moving DJ knowledge. From 808 slow jams to confetti-ready anthems, Award is a four-track collection of earworms featuring voices from the underground (Newark’s Dougie F and UNiiQU3) and radio (Jeremih collaborator Sayyi) alike.

We say this after every Labor Day… but this year’s Day Off was our absolute craziest yet! Thousands of party people took over 50 Kent to rock with Fool’s Gold family and friends. The day brought sets from Danny Brown, French Montana, A-Trak, Araabmuzik, The Lox, Brenmar, Hoodboi B2B Falcons, Yung Gleesh, World’s Fair, Nick Catchdubs feat B.I.C., Shash’u, Black Dave, GrandeMarshall, Cakes Da Killa and Ruff Ryders young’n Lil Waah. And let’s not forget the surprise guests! French Montana brought out BK’s own Bobby Shmurda, while A-Trak surprised the crowd with Remy Ma, Cam’ron, A$AP Nast, iLoveMakonnen, and Travi$ Scott, and Black Dave repped for the home team with Smoke DZA. Desus & Mero held us down on the host tip with their bodega stand up (complete with assists from Rosenberg, Miss Info, Ebro and the Hot 97 crew). It was truly one for the books…
